According to a recent LinkedIn post from Bolt, Regional Director for Rides Operations Caroline reflects on her three-year tenure overseeing business across Africa and Southeast Asia. The post emphasizes her role in connecting technology, drivers, and riders to ensure earnings, safety, and reliability in markets from Nairobi to Bangkok.

The post highlights themes of leadership development, non-linear career moves into tech, and the operational challenges and opportunities for women in leadership roles. It also notes that Bolt is currently recruiting, suggesting ongoing investment in regional operations and talent that could support the company’s growth in emerging mobility markets.
For investors, the focus on operational leadership across multiple regions signals continued emphasis on execution at scale in ride-hailing verticals. The leadership narrative and hiring call may indicate Bolt’s intention to deepen market penetration and strengthen organizational capacity, which could be relevant for assessing its long-term competitiveness and expansion strategy.
